English: SAN DIEGO (Feb. 9, 2009) Capt. Gregory Blaschke, medical director, Medical and Surgical Simulation Center at Naval Medical Center San Diego, right, demonstrates the mobile child trainer mannequin for Rear Adm. Thomas R. Cullison, Medical Corps Deputy Surgeon General Vice Chief, Bureau of Medicine and Surgery. (U.S. Navy photo by Mass Communication Specialist 2nd Class Greg Mitchell/Released) |
